The Chinese broadsword (dao or daoshu) was a popular infantry weapon and is most often associated with the monks of Shao Lin (as opposed to the monks and nuns of Wu Dan, who are legendary straightsword practitioners). The single edged, curved blade is used primarily for cuts and chops, although most broadsword styles also include thrusts. The broadsword style relies heavily on circular motions, passing the blade around the body in order to defend attacks from any angle and to counter with dazzling speed.
